General Guidelines
• Placeallcontainerssothattheopeningallowssteamtoenter,andair/condensatetodrain
from the container.
• UseonlyM9andM11traysintheirappropriatesterilizer.
Usingothertrayscouldrestrictair/steamowtoitems.
• Sterilizejointeditemsinanopenposition.
• Handpiecesandinstrumentsmustbesingleheightloaded(notpiledorstacked),topermit
propersteamowandpenetrationtotheitems.
Immediate Use Sterilization
The M9 and M11 are capable of Immediate Use sterilization - sterilizing unwrapped instruments for immedi-
ateuse.Placeatowelorabsorbentpaperonthebottomofthetraybeforeputtingunwrappeditemsinthe
tray.Pleaseconsiderthefollowingwhenchoosingwhetherornottosterilizeyourinstrumentsunwrapped:
• Thesterilityofunwrappedinstrumentsiscompromiseduponexposuretoanon-sterile
environment.FollowCDCguidelinesforusingunwrapped,sterilizedinstruments.
• Duetothesensitivenatureofsometypesofsurgery(including,butnotlimitedto
ophthalmological),instrumentsusedinsuchproceduresmustbewrappedorpouchedin
ordertoreducetheirexposuretosterilizationprocessresidues.Thewaterreservoirshould
alsobedrainedandrelledwithfreshdistilledwateronadailybasiswhenprocessing
instruments for these procedures on a routine basis.
Pouching and Wrapping Items
The M9 and M11 are capable of sterilizing pouched or wrapped items to preserve sterility after processing.
• Whenpouchingorwrappingitems,useonlysterilizerpouchesandwrapsthathavebeen
cleared by the FDA and labeled for use with the steam sterilization cycle being used.
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for use.
• WhenusingcassettesintheM9/M11,followthemanufacturer’sinstructionsforuse.
• Donotwrapitemstootightly.Sterilizationcanbecompromisedifanitemisexcessivelywrapped.
• Pouchesshouldbelooselypackedandmayoverlap,buthandpiecesandinstrumentsmustbe
singleheightloaded(notpiledorstacked),topermitpropersteamflowandpenetrationtotheitems.
• Thepreferredorientationofpouchesisrestingontheiredge,bestaccomplishedusingthe
Midmarkpouchrackaccessory.Ifusingthestandardtray,pouchesshouldbeplacedwithpaper
side down.
Caution
Clean and dry instruments thoroughly before placing them into tray. Improper cleaning may
result in non-sterile instruments or damage to the unit. Follow instrument manufacturer’s
guidelines and CDC recommendations for handling and cleaning instruments prior to sterilization.
